Our Finance team plays an integral role in making our airline profitable and successful by meeting our financial goals.Job Overview And ResponsibilitiesThe Senior Accountant supports the financial operations of United Aviate Academy. Responsible for all financial processes including budget tracking, billing, receivables, payables, financial reporting/statements, forecasting, month-end, quarter-end, and year-end closes, contract planning/financial review, payroll, revenue recognition, light tax related functions, analysis and reporting, and audit preparation.Work closely with and report to the Director, Finance Controller working in partnership with the parent company United and their accounting/finance/treasury team members. Collaborate with a small team covering payroll, receivables, and payables.Accounts Payable Processes, vendor payments, review expense reports for payment, invoice coding, preparation of check ride invoices to studentsHandle employee reimbursements and credit card account management, including auditing and analysisProvide support on staff inquiries related to budgets, deposits, disbursements, contract analysis, reporting, and transfer of payments via ACH, wire, or file feeds. Serve as a trusted business advisor by building strong relationships across departments and the parent companyPreparation and research of journal entries in Workday & Oracle for month-end, quarter-end, and year-end close, including fixed assetsPreparation of monthly balance sheet account reconciliationsReconciliation of Intercompany accounting with UnitedDevelop and implement accounting and finance processes and proceduresIdentify opportunities for process improvements to streamline consistency and efficiencies across financial operationsPreparation of year-end books and audit schedules, and coordination with internal and external auditors on requests for auditsThis position is offered on local terms and conditions.
